Every day brings spring a day closer, meaning it’s time to start thinking about and planting those spring vegetable and flower gardens.

The Norman Public Library will host a Garden Workshop and Seed Exchange at 10 a.m. Tuesday, Feb. 14, in the Lowry Room of the library, 225 N. Webster Ave. Gardeners with the greenest of thumbs, as well as those just wanting to have a more productive garden in 2012, are invited.

 

Dr. Norm Park, an expert local gardener, will lead attendees through the process of successfully starting seeds.

At the conclusion of the workshop there will be a seed swap, so participants are encouraged to bring saved or excess seeds to trade.

Registration is not required to take part.
